Natural lawyers, however, such as Jean-Jacques Rousseau, argue that law reflects basically ethical and unchangeable laws of nature. The concept of “pure law” emerged in historical Greek philosophy concurrently and in connection with the notion of justice, and re-entered the mainstream of Western tradition through the writings of Thomas Aquinas, notably his Treatise on Law.
